WebTypes of Java programs. There are many types of Java programs which run differently: Java Applet - small program written in Java and that is downloaded from a website and executed within a web browser on a client computer. Application - executes on a client computer. If online, it has to be downloaded before being run. When a number of objects are created from the same class blueprint, they each have their own distinct copies of instance variables. In the case of the Bicycle class, the instance variables are cadence, gear, and speed. Each Bicycle object has its own values for these variables, stored in different memory locations.

I wish to avoid the overhead of trying to import/declare statements for each class I use, and wanted to use a single one; which I thought would be possible by using an interface, but seems that is not the case. – gagneet Nov 27, 2024 at … indian takeaway ashford middlesexWeb20 sep. 2024 · Nested classes are divided into two types − Non-static nested classes (Inner Classes) − These are the non-static members of a class. Static nested classes − These are the static members of a class.
